2. The chain teeth point alternately in
the opposite direction to each other.
First sharpen one set of teeth, then
turn the saw and sharpen the other set
of teeth. The teeth must be sharpened
from the side they point out towards.
Mark the first tooth with a felt-tip pen or
similar, so that you can see when you
have sharpened the teeth all the way
around on the chain.
3. Place the file against a tooth, and
push the file forward at an angle of 30°
in relation to the blade.
Do not pull the file back, but lift it up
and file forward again.
File each tooth with the same number
of strokes of the file.
4. The top of the file should protrude
approximately 1/5 up above the tooth.
5. Finally, file any riders using a depth-
gauge tool and a flat file. The riders
must all have the same height and be
approximately 0.65 mm lower than the
teeth.

Replacing the chain
When the chain is worn, replace it.
Remove the chain and blade as de-
scribed under "Assembly and Prepara-
tion".
Take the chain off the blade, and clean
the blade, protective cover and engine
housing thoroughly with compressed
air or a brush. Take special care to clean
the oil feed to the blade and the chain.
Check for blade and chain wheel wear
and replace if necessary.
Note! Do not dispose of used chains
in your domestic refuse. Dispose of
them correctly in accordance with local
legislation.
Fit the new chain onto the blade.
Checking the blade
Place a try square against the blade and
press it against the chain. If there is an
opening between the try square and the
blade, the blade is OK.
